Phil Zuckerman Lecture: Society Without God

Sociologist Phil Zuckerman traveled to Scandinavia to ask godless Danes and Swedes—their collective lives measurably better, more stable, more humane than ours—why they don’t worship invisible, tyrannical deities. You can pretend not to know the answer—or be surprised at the U.S. Senate Chaplain’s recent claim that Senators pray on their knees in his office, seeking counsel from the supernatural on public policy. Then get over it, quick, and hear Zuckerman discuss his book, Society Without God: What the Least Religious Nations Can Tell Us About Contentment. Just sayin’, er, prayin’.
